What is recorded here

This green commemorative plaque records: On this site stood the workhouse which provided shelter for destitute Irish migrants in the years of the Great Famine 1845-52. Remember the Great Famine
The Liverpool workhouse served as a critical refuge for impoverished Irish migrants fleeing the Great Famine, highlighting the city's role in addressing humanitarian crises during the mid-19th century.
